Infectious bronchitis virus serotypes in poultry flocks in Jordan

Summary
This study investigated infectious bronchitis virus (IBV) in Jordanian chickens. While 70% showed recent IBV exposure, specific serotypes remain undetermined due to similar antibody responses.
Area of Science:
- Avian health
- Veterinary virology
- Immunology
Background:
- Infectious bronchitis virus (IBV) is a global cause of respiratory illness in chickens.
- IBV exhibits diverse serotypes lacking cross-protection, complicating disease management.
- Limited research exists on IBV serotypes involved in Jordanian poultry respiratory disease.
Purpose of the Study:
- To investigate the presence and serotypes of IBV in chicken flocks experiencing respiratory disease in Jordan.
- To establish baseline data on IBV seroprevalence and circulating strains within Jordan.
Main Methods:
- Serum samples from 20 affected chicken flocks were tested for IBV antibodies using ELISA.
- Positive flocks (14/20) showing increased antibody titers were further analyzed.
- Hemagglutination inhibition (HI) tests were performed on these samples against five IBV serotype antigens.
Main Results:
- A significant increase in IBV antibody titers (70% of flocks) indicated recent infection.
- HI tests suggested exposure to Ark, DE-072, and Mass-like IBV serotypes in some flocks.
- In 71% of positive flocks, HI titers were too similar across tested antigens to definitively identify the IBV serotype.
Conclusions:
- IBV is actively circulating and causing respiratory disease in Jordanian chicken flocks.
- The study highlights challenges in serotyping IBV using the HI test when antibody responses are not distinct.
- Further research is needed to identify the specific IBV serotypes prevalent in Jordan.

Respiratory Syncytial Virus Disease
Human respiratory syncytial virus (RSV) is a widespread pathogen that primarily targets infants and young children but also poses a serious health risk to elderly and immunocompromised individuals. Belonging to the Pneumoviridae family, RSV is a negative-sense, single-stranded RNA virus within the Pneumovirus genus. Chickenpox
Chickenpox is an acute, highly contagious disease caused by the varicella-zoster virus (VZV), a double-stranded DNA virus belonging to the Herpesviridae family. Its transmission occurs primarily through the inhalation of respiratory droplets or direct contact with vesicular fluid from skin lesions. The incubation period typically ranges from 10 to 21 days, during which the virus replicates and disseminates through sequential phases within the host. Influenza
Influenza is an acute, highly communicable viral disease that affects the respiratory tract and is responsible for seasonal epidemics worldwide. Influenza A is the most prevalent type associated with widespread outbreaks and is subtyped based on two surface glycoproteins: hemagglutinin (H) and neuraminidase (N), as in H1N1. Poliomyelitis
Poliomyelitis is caused by poliovirus, a small, non-enveloped, positive-sense RNA virus of the Picornaviridae family and Enterovirus genus. Transmission occurs primarily via the fecal-oral route, often through ingestion of contaminated water or food. The virus initially replicates in the oropharynx and intestinal mucosa, particularly in lymphoid tissues such as the tonsils, Peyer’s patches, and regional lymph nodes.
